Why Was July a Bumper Month for Rough-Diamond Trading?

Assessing the impact of De Beers, Alrosa, Angola — and the tariffs.
Rough diamond image

Rough-diamond shipments into some of the most important trading centers surged in July, raising several questions about the state of the market.

India’s rough imports rose 26% year on year by value to $1.15 billion for the month, according to data the country’s Gem & Jewellery Export Promotion Council (GJEPC) released this week. By volume, imports increased 28%…
